In interviews, the team has spoken about how the game's eponymous stray is based on a real cat, Mertaugh, who was adopted by studio heads Viv and Koola after he was discovered under a car.

The weird robot city is also based on a real place: the infamous Walled City of Kowloon in Hong Kong, which was demolished in 1994, but which was genuinely an enclosed, densely populated skyscraper city. It didn't have as many robots as the city in Stray, of course.
